Mont. Code Ann. § 33-2-103

Admission for investment only

A foreign insurer may transact business in this state without certificate of authority for the purpose and to the extent only of investing its funds in Montana real estate or in securities secured thereby by complying with the applicable laws of this state other than this code. Such an insurer shall not be subject to any other provision of this code.
